Closed Systems in System Theory There is open and close system in this System Theory. Open systems adapt quickly to the environment in which they live by possessing permeable boundaries through which new information and ideas are readily absorbed. By incorporating viable, new ideas, an open system ultimately sustains growth and serves its parent environment. Open systems possess a stronger probability for survival due to this adaptability. Conversely, a closed system resisting the incorporation of new ideas can be deemed unnecessary to its parent environment and risks atrophy.By not adopting or imps, a closed system ceases to properly serve the environment it lives in.
